首页 / 日本服务器 / 正文
服务器时差问题,影响、原因与解决方案,服务器时差问题怎么解决

Time:2025年01月08日 Read:5 评论:42 作者:y21dr45

在当今全球化和数字化的时代,服务器扮演着至关重要的角色,无论是企业的数据存储、网站的运行,还是应用程序的托管,服务器都是不可或缺的基础设施,随着业务的扩展和全球化的发展,服务器时差问题逐渐成为一个不可忽视的挑战,本文将深入探讨服务器时差问题的影响、原因以及可行的解决方案。

服务器时差问题,影响、原因与解决方案,服务器时差问题怎么解决

一、服务器时差问题的影响

1、用户体验不佳

当用户访问位于不同地理位置的服务器时,可能会遇到响应延迟的问题,这种延迟不仅会影响网页加载速度,还可能导致应用程序性能下降,从而降低用户体验。

2、数据同步困难

多台服务器之间的数据同步是许多分布式系统的核心功能,由于服务器可能分布在不同的时区,数据同步过程中可能会出现时间戳不一致的情况,进而导致数据混乱或丢失。

3、安全性风险增加

时差问题还可能增加系统的安全性风险,某些安全机制依赖于时间戳来验证请求的有效性,如果服务器之间的时间不一致,可能会被恶意用户利用进行重放攻击或其他形式的安全威胁。

4、运维复杂性提高

对于跨时区的运维团队来说,服务器时差问题会增加工作的复杂性和难度,在排查故障或进行系统升级时,需要考虑不同服务器的当地时间,这可能会导致沟通不畅和操作失误。

二、服务器时差问题的原因

1、全球分布的数据中心

为了提高服务的可用性和响应速度,许多企业选择在全球多个地点部署数据中心,这些数据中心可能位于不同的时区,从而导致服务器时间不一致。

2、NTP(网络时间协议)配置不当

NTP是一种用于同步计算机时钟的协议,如果服务器的NTP配置不正确,或者无法访问可靠的NTP服务器,就可能导致服务器时间不准确。

3、操作系统和硬件差异

不同操作系统和硬件平台对时间的管理和同步方式可能有所不同,这种差异可能导致在某些情况下服务器时间出现偏差。

4、人为因素

运维人员在进行系统配置或维护时,可能无意中更改了服务器的时区设置或关闭了NTP服务,从而导致时间不一致的问题。

三、解决服务器时差问题的方案

1、统一使用UTC时间

为了避免时差带来的问题,可以将所有服务器的时间设置为协调世界时(UTC),这样,无论服务器位于哪个时区,其内部时间都是一致的,便于数据同步和故障排查。

2、正确配置NTP服务

确保所有服务器都能够访问可靠的NTP服务器,并正确配置NTP服务,这样,服务器可以自动与标准时间源同步,保持时间的准确性。

3、使用分布式时间同步工具

对于需要高精度时间同步的场景,可以使用如Chrony、PTP(精确时间协议)等分布式时间同步工具,这些工具能够提供更高精度的时间同步服务,减少时间偏差。

4、定期检查和维护

定期对服务器的时间设置进行检查和维护,确保所有服务器的时间都保持一致,监控NTP服务的状态,及时发现并解决问题。

5、培训和文档

对运维人员进行培训,提高他们对服务器时间管理重要性的认识,制定详细的操作文档和流程,指导运维人员如何正确配置和维护服务器时间。

服务器时差问题虽然看似微小,但其影响却可能波及整个系统的运行效率和安全性,通过统一使用UTC时间、正确配置NTP服务、使用高精度时间同步工具以及定期检查和维护等措施,我们可以有效解决这一问题,确保系统的稳定运行和数据的准确性,在未来,随着技术的不断发展和全球化的进一步深入,服务器时差问题仍将是一个需要持续关注和解决的问题。

标签: 服务器时差问题 
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1